Back ground
In general terms, investment means the use of
money in the hope of making more money. In finance,
investment is defined as the purchase of a financial
product or other item of value with the expectation of
earning favorable returns in the future these returns
may be used by the investors as per their needs like
wealth accrual, liquidity, safety in time of emergency,
portfolio diversification, retirement planning etc.
They are many investment options available to the
indian investors some of these are bank fd’s, public
provident funds, real estate, insurance policies,
mutual funds etc. One such investment option is
investment in the stock market.
What is stock market?
A stock market is a public market (virtual
environment), not a physical facility for the trading of
companies, stock and derivatives. These includes
securities listed on stock exchange as well as those
only traded privately a stock exchange is an organized
market which provides services for stock brokers and
traders to trade stocks, bonds and other securities.
Market participants include individual retail
investors, institutional investors such as mutual
funds, banks, insurance companies and also publicly
traded corporation trading in their own shares in this
research, we would be focusing on individual
investors.
A stock market (also known as an equity market
or share market), is a collection of buyers and
sellers of stocks. These stocks represent ownership
interests in companies. These may include publicly
or privately traded securities. The new york stock
exchange (nyse) is an example of a share market.
As of 2017, the global stock market is now
worth a record $76.3 trillion. The nyse has a
market capitalization of roughly $21 trillion and is
the largest stock market in the world.

Scope of investor behavior


Behavior is the study of the influence of
psychology on
the behavior of investors or financial analysts. It
also includes the subsequent effects on the markets. It
focuses on the fact that investors are not always
rational, have limits to
their self-control, and are influenced by their own
biases.

Approach of investors while investing


 Value investing. An investment strategy made popular
by warren buffet, the principle behind
value investing is simple: buy stocks that are cheaper
than they should be.
